Master Thesis Work - Simulation for predicting airborne noise of drivelines with noise shields


Background:

Volvo Penta drivelines operate in a huge number of environments and vehicles.

There is a need of low emitted noise due to care of the environment and satisfied customers.

The inherent driveline parts must be optimized for low noise.

Noise shields of different materials with different noise cancelling efficiencies are commonly used to reduce the noise even further.

At Volvo Penta there is a need of understanding and to develop a simulation method to predict the effect of different noise shields and barriers.

Simulations must be done early in projects to ensure that the products will meet the Volvo Penta and the customer requirements



Thesis work objective:

Aim

The objective of this thesis is to create a model and perform air borne noise simulations in Actran of a driveline or component that include a noise shield and correlate this to measurements.


First step

A literature study should be performed to find existing studies regarding air borne noise simulation and modelling of the most common materials used in noise shields outside and within Volvo Group.


Second step

Perform measurement for material calibration.


Third step

Create a simulation model that include a noise shield and calibrate with measurement data.
